About Guang Wen

Guang Wen is a scholar working on Soil Science, Atmospheric Science and Environmental Chemistry, having authored 33 papers that have together received 629 indexed citations. Recurring topics across this work include Meteorological Phenomena and Simulations (10 papers), Precipitation Measurement and Analysis (8 papers) and Soil Carbon and Nitrogen Dynamics (7 papers). The work is most often cited by research in Soil Science (313 citations), Industrial and Manufacturing Engineering (101 citations) and Agronomy and Crop Science (114 citations). Guang Wen has collaborated with scholars based in Canada, China and Japan. Frequent co-authors include D. Curtin, R. P. Voroney, Thomas E. Bates, R.P. Zentner, V. O. Biederbeck, V. Rasiah, C. A. Campbell, J.J. Schoenau, Hui Xiao and Tahei Yamamoto. Their work appears in journals such as Soil Biology and Biochemistry, Soil Science Society of America Journal and Plant and Soil.
